The snake coiled under itself and "sat up" in a way that only a legless reptile could do. It's forked tongue flicked out in front of it and its yellow and black eyes observed the scattered remnants of Kasumi's collection of herbs.
"You dropped you things," it said. The voice was very human sounding, not containing the hiss that one might expect from a talking snake. It was also a womanly voice, calm and measured. It did not seem embarrassed at having shocked her. Snakes probably got that reaction from young women all the time.
"You are new here. I have not seen you before." The snake's head weaved first left, and then right, looking at Kasumi intently. "Who and what might you be?"
